I am usually suspicious of restaurants with a view, as the food has never wow'ed me at these restaurants, even if they appear in the Michelin guide. From its terrace, Murver Restaurant has a gorgeous view of the Bosphorus, Hagia Sophia, and Blue Mosque, *and* serves great food. I would describe its food as modern Mediterranean -- interesting takes on some traditional Mediterranean flavor profiles. Our group's favorites: * Duck with cinnamon, cherry, hummus, walnut * Burnt pumpkin with yogurt sauce * Baked artichokes with spicy raisins, artichoke sauce, and celery oil * Octopus with vegetables, sumac, isot, and pomegranate syrup * Grilled chicken with sliced potatoes * Grilled sirloin steak * Seafood stew with green herb sauce When dining here, I can easily lose track of time. The view of the slow passing cruise ships is very relaxing. I could order drink after drink just to sit here. Hey, I didn't say they have to be alcohol.

Located on the Novotel İstanbul Bosphorus rooftop Mürver features the cooking of Chef Mevlüt Özkaya, a focus on seasonal open-fire cooking yielding big flavors that pair well to Turkish Wines and a privileged view of the Golden Horn plus Asia. A trendy spot by Turkish standards, with music and a lounge setting the tone, it is en route to seats that guests will notice an open kitchen where fire burns brightly turning out everything from small plates to large format shareables and a Tasting Menu. Centered on the oven, a youthful team working quietly, warm Sourdough arrives to accompany crisp local Riesling with an Arugula Salad, smoky Pears and cave-aged Sheep's Cheese soon to follow. Known for grilled Octopus as well as Confit Duck with cold Hummus, Cherries and Walnuts, it comes as no surprise that Lamb is featured in several forms including smoked Shoulder served rare between Quince and Walnuts. With the Restaurant since day one, Chef Özkaya officially taking the reins in 2021, Bükme elevates comfort Food with flaky Pastry containing Beef ready to be dipped in Yogurt while housemade Pickles cleanse the palate between bites. Raised at Grandma's elbow in the kitchen with training furthered at some of Turkey's top tables Dessert sees Mürver update classics with technique and quality produce, the "Burnt Antep Pistachio" something of a Pave beneath assertive Ice Cream while Charred Pumpkin dances thanks to savory Sauce and a cold perfume of Cumin.

It's very good and well worth a visit. We went here for Fathers Day upon the recommendation of the hotel concierge. Apparently this place is known for cocktails and they have a huge list. I went with a Smoky Mary which was some type of Bloody Mary with a peppery kick to it. It was excellent. Daughter had a mock tail which was sweet and delicious. Not sure what was in it. After a drink we sat down at a table with a great view of the Bosporus and city. Could see Blue Mosque and Ayasofia from our chairs. Went with hummus and herbs encrusted in dough to start. Very good. Mains were roasted chicken which was cooked nicely and a sirloin steak. We skipped desert. Prices reasonable to boot for what we got. Check it out!!

Great view (go before the sun sets) and great outdoor space for drinks or dinner. I have only a vague idea of what we ate, since I trusted our Turkish friends to do the sharing in the middle plates. For starters..We had octopus, hummus with lamb which was excellent with a sweet cinnamon flavor, a intestine pizza sounds gross but was quite good, a thick yogurt and nice crusty bread also as sides. For our main we had lamb with a lentil side- a great crisp skin and a oxtail on a light bread with a creamy cheese- very good with a rich flavor. Wine pairings and cocktails also very well done. The waiter spoke English for me and they have English menus, so don't feel intimidated. Great night out.
